    On today's show, we feature Steps Ahead and music from their Magnetic release, plus Mike Mainieri, Mitchell Forman and John Scofield.

    Playlist

    • Steps Ahead "Beirut" from Magnetic (Elektra) 00:00
    • Mike Mainieri "Flying Colours" fromWanderlust (NYC) 06:12
    • Steve Khan "Guy Lefleur" from Eyewitness (Antilles) 12:27
    • Metro "Bing Bam Boom" from Tree People (Lipstick) 18:42
    • Mitchell Forman "Lock It Up" from Hand Made (Lipstick) 24:48
    • Carl Filipiak "Blue Entrance" from Peripheral Vision (Geometric) 30:52
    • Stanton Moore "(Who Ate) The Layer Cake" from Emphesis On The Parenthesis (Telarc) 49:33
